Regalti - Color Perception and meaning




Article Contents

Describe the common symbols and color associations with a culture in your world.
  The Regalti as a species have the ability to see into the UV spectrum of light, having evolved it millions of years ago. Combined with the color changing abilities of their skin, and the variety of colors their feathers can come in, they have developed their own system of color associations and symbolism.    

Color Meanings

A note on Skin Color

Regardless of the natural tone of a Regalti's skin, changes in body temperature or being flush with emotion will cause nanocrystals under the skin to move apart, come closer together, or change shape entirely, which allows them to reflect longer and shorter wavelengths of light. They generally do not have control over this.
 
This also causes their skin to reflect or absorb UV light, which, to anyone who can see UV radiation, will make them appear brighter and even slightly violet, or darker and more grayed out. To anyone who can't see UV light, they won't be able to accurately read Regalti emotions unless they also look for facial expression and body posture.

Colors and Meanings

Red - Fire, Royalty, Happiness, Rage, Strength, War, God

Red is a color of strong emotions and represents happiness and anger. It is also a great way to tell if a Regalti is uncomfortably hot or even overheating. Facial expression is still important in communication between Regalti, because a smiling red Regalti is likely not dying of heat exposure.
 
Red also represents the concepts of War, Fire, and Royalty. It is also the 'Color of God', because in Collena's atmosphere, the star Ventar appears as a deep red color. The star is a representation of the only god or chief god in many Regalti faiths on Collena. (On Sephar, the star looks more orange, making that the color of God)
 

Orange - Curiosity, Anticipation, impatience

Orange is a color of 'warmer than neutral' emotions, being frustrated at something but not quite angry, Anticipating something, on the verge of anger or happiness depending on how it goes.

This color represents unpredictability and chaos because to Regalti, anticipation and frustration can just as easily turn the other direction into sadness, sorrow, fear, and other emotions.
 

Yellow - Neutral, Stability, Acceptance, Calm

Yellow is considered the neutral color for the Regalti. It represents acceptance and tolerance.
 
It is the main color their skin naturally reflects, though underlying blood vessels and varying pigment levels actually make them appear rose, orange, or brown colored. And when reflecting or absorbing UV light, their skin appears to be relatively close to their natural skin color anyways, which is why Yellow's primary symbol and emotion is one of neutrality and calm, even though Regalti skin is normally incapable of showing as any true yellow color.
 
If a Regalti's skin is able to turn yellow, they are one of the rare Regalti able to do so, but if they live on the surface of a high gravity world, especially their home world, it is recommended they get themselves screened for Magnesiosarcoma, a cancer that is usually known as "Surface Sickness".
 
Collena orbits a yellow-white star that appears yellow in the planet's atmosphere. Early Regalti considered their Star to be the stable force that all of creation revolves around.
 
 

Green - Calm, Serenity, Apprehension, Balance

Green is considered the calm color for Regalti, as there is no strong associated emotion with it. It is also the color that many higher latitude plants are, which for northern and souther cultures, it also means life. Is is the color of "cooler than neutral" emotions.
 
To some Regalti, Green appears more yellow than green, and some cultures don't distinguish the two at all, which is why both Yellow and Green represent Calm.
 

Cyan - Fear, Surprise, Water, Air, Confusion, Instability, Chaos

Cyan represents both Water and Air, or more accurately, the clouds in the air and the storms they create. Lower Latitude plants tend to be slightly more cyan than green, which, along with it representing water, is why Regalti associate this color with life. It represents instability, and like Orange, represents Chaos as well.
 
Emotionally, Cyan represents fear, terror, and surprise. Fear and Terror are very similar emotions, and are often considered the same thing. To the Regalti, they are not. To put it in a simple way, fear is what a Regalti feels after a jumpscare, or are being chased by something, or are afraid of something happening. Terror is what a Regalti feels after understanding something that shakes them to their core, that causes them to lose a bit of their sanity, the look in their eyes before they die.
 

Blue - Sadness, Depression, loneliness, Longing, Cold, Ice, the Oceans

Blue is a cold color, a lonly color, a depressing color. It depresses Regalti even writing about it. A Regalti that is freezing to death will also be this color.
 

Near Violet - Sympathy, Love, admiration, compassion, friendship, Spirituality

Near violet is the color of comrades for Regalti. It is the color of friendship, compassion, love. Regalty associate it with spirituality, and often change into this color as they pray, feeling they are getting closer to their god.
 
When Regalti are in this state, and the far violet state, their blood vessels expand irregularly, creating pockets that reflect blue light, and pockets that reflect red light, making them appear violet. Normally, Regalti skin is incapable of making this color.
 

Far Violet - Passion, Excitement, Energy, Purity, Extravagance

Far violet is the color of passion, energy, and excitement. Blood vessels are even more irregular, and the expansion falls completely out of sync, sometimes creating bands of 'rainbow' skin between the dark purples. This is especially apparent during sexual activity. in the UV spectrum, a Regalti appears much more vibrant in this state than any other, reflecting and absorbing UV light at the maximum level their skin structure allows. In visible light, they appear darker than in any other state.

Other Colors

These are other colors that exist but have no emotional association. (Will be expanded as necessary as time goes on)
███ Black - Darkness, the Void.

███ Gray - Center, Green, Calm.

███ Silver - Wealth, Sickness.
███ white - Light, Everything, Death.

███ Pink - Spirit.

███ Gold - Wealth, Wellbeing.

A Note about the cover image

Regalti Visible spectrum by Chrispy_0
The cover image is a close approximation of how the Regalti percieve color. They can see into the UV spectrum down to 275-325nm, and can see red light up to 700-725nm. By comparison humans typically see light from 380nm to 750nm.
The brightest colors in a Regalti's perception is Cyan. Far-violet is the second brightest, which sits just outside the visible spectrum of light for humans, with Blue and Violet in-between as the third brightest colors. Red is the dimmest color to them.
The colors Humans typically percieve as the brightest color, yellow-green, are not that distinguishable for a Regalti. In fact, they sometimes just call Green and Yellow the same thing. This is also true for the color Orange sometimes being the same as the word for Red. These distinctions do not occur simultaneously in any Regalti Culture.

 

Color, Clothing, and Gender

As a byproduct of evolution, males tend to reflect more UV light in their skin and feathers, and females are more attracted to these brighter colors and reflected UV light. As a result of this, Males are more likely to wear the colors that Regalti percieve to be the boldest and brightest, which are Violets, Cyans, and Reds. Females are more likely to wear Oranges, Greens, and Blues. Either gender is equally likely to wear Yellow, Pink, Black, White, and Grays.

Religious and traditional clothing tends to be white with saturated colors. modern and contemporary wear is generally bright, but there are so many styles and patterns that almost anything is possible. Formal wear tends to be more subdued and always reflects uv light, always making it appear darker. Funerary wear is almost always gray, sometimes with subdued colors.




 

How to hide emotions

Having skin like a moodstone might make it rather easy for another sentient species or fellow Regalti to tell exactly what they are feeling at any given time, but it is more complicated than that. Because the way their skin color changes is mainly a function of body temperature and movement of blood vessels, all a Regalti has to do to confuse others is to wear uncomfortably warm or cool clothing.

If it is 27°C outside and a Regalti is wearing a thick sweater, they will almost always appear red, regardless of emotion. So they may be happy, or angry, or even afraid, you won't know. If it's 0°C outside and they aren't wearing that same sweater, they will appear blue, even if they are in a state of terror or utter rage. At this point, the only way to know for sure is to rely on traits that most sentient species have, such as facial expression or body language, and at that point, it isn't too difficult for a Regalti to fake those expressions.

It is also possible to steel the body and mind to hide skin color, regardless of emotion, and appear red or any other color, even when shirtless in a blizzard. This takes a great deal of practice and concentration. Usually diplomats and soldiers have this skill. Religious monks are also known to have this skill.
